Recommended for
Streamlit is ideal for data scientists, analysts, and developers looking to rapidly prototype and deploy data-driven applications. It is recommended for those who prioritize simplicity, quick deployment, and seamless integration with Python code. Individuals or teams interested in building dashboards, ML model sharing platforms, or interactive reports will find Streamlit particularly useful.
